    The Bitter Buddha - An Eddie Pepitone Documentary

    So, a page needs to get started for this film. It also features Patton Oswalt, Sarah Silverman, Zach Galifianakis, Todd Glass, Dana Gould, Marc Maron and a bunch of other great comics.
